gpt4 book ai didi

javascript - 当其他 div 具有相同的类时,在您悬停的 div 上添加 Class

转载 作者:行者123 更新时间:2023-11-28 15:29:21 25 4
gpt4 key购买 nike

我有一个问题,我想在悬停时将类添加到下面的部分 div 之一:

<div class="container">
<div class="section">Stuff</div>
<div class="section">Stuff</div>
<div class="section">Stuff</div>
<div class="section">Stuff</div>
<div class="section">Stuff</div>
</div>

此代码将类添加到所有类中,我怎样才能使其成为您将鼠标悬停在其上的类?我阅读了 jquery .next 但也无法让它工作。注意:节 div 来自循环并且都是相同的类名,我无法更改它。

jQuery 是:

jQuery(".container .section").hover(
function() {
jQuery(".section").addClass("selected");
},
function() {
jQuery(".section").removeClass("selected");
}
);

fiddle @ http://jsfiddle.net/8juoy2vz/

最佳答案

试试这个,($(this) 引用当前元素,在我们的例子中它将是 .section 之一)

jQuery(".container .section").hover(
function() {
$(this).addClass("selected");
},
function() {
$(this).removeClass("selected");
}
);

Example

关于javascript - 当其他 div 具有相同的类时,在您悬停的 div 上添加 Class,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27951720/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com